The Senior Information Analyst will
- Work with Business Intelligence Leads, Delivery Managers and Analytics Business Partners to refine information requirements.
- Work both independently, and as part of a multi-disciplinary squad to provide meaningful insights as required.
- Utilise tools and various data sources to provide the best-fit solution to operational and clinical asks and analysis.
- Work iteratively with colleagues to ensure requirements are met.

We are an acute trust caring for over one million people in Wakefield and Kirklees. Our 10,000 staff work in patients homes, the community, and our three hospitals in Pontefract, Dewsbury, and Pinderfields (Wakefield).
We prioritise our people and values so we can deliver the best possible care to patients. Our team is friendly, passionate, and innovative, always seeking better ways to work.
